Postby HaMagist » Tue Sep 26, 2006 5:10 pm

One suitcase should do you well too, there is laundry on kibbutz. If you opt to stay on the kibbutz as a soldier - check to see what the arrangements and obligations are - you're probably going to be sharing a room or small apartment. Don't assume you'll have generous or suitable (protected from all the elements) storage.

Obviously an apartmenty is a more desireable option, but that means paying rent on a place you're only occupying x% of the time.

Postby Dan from Boston » Tue Sep 26, 2006 7:39 pm

It's more like 1050NIS, and that's enough to get a nice place if you have a room-mate or two and spend enough time searching using the right resources. It will not get you beachside property in Herzelliyah-Pituach. But especially if you want to live in Jerusalem with a room-mate, it's plenty.
